Just adding that the more I use it, the more of a poor user experience it is. In previous betas, the folder would show up in the Task Switcher (One Hand Operation), so you could go back and lock it. With the most recent beta, they've removed it from the Task Switcher, which I agree with as it adds additional security. But if you have all your Samsung apps in another folder, it's more taps to get back to the Secure Folder just to tap the 3 dot menu to lock it again.
Please bring back the option to immediately lock the folder when closed! This option should never have been removed. Thanks!
